    Gifted/Talented & Advanced Academic Services

    Students who enter our campuses "ready to go" as either expert or advanced learners will find choices supporting annual academic growth. The G/T & AAS system of offerings seeks to find areas of student strength and accomplishment and provides services that encourage a year of growth for each school year. The Midland ISD Board of Trustees approved the following provisions:

    • Elementary services:
      • QUEST for Kindergarten G/T pull-out in the Spring semester,
      • GEM (Gifted Education Midland) 1.0: Grades 1-6 full-time campus services at Carver Center
      • GEM 2.0: Grades 1-6 pull-out sessions at Carver Center one day every other week at Carver Center
      • Midland Academic Scholars (MAS) enrichment services for potential G/T K_2 students 
    • Secondary campuses:
      • Designated G/T sections in advanced studies on each campus to include but not be limited to
        • College Board AP® courses
        • Courses in preparation for AP® courses,
        • dual credit courses,
        • PSAT and SAT preparation,
        • Academic Decathlon, and
        • Others determined to be beneficial to the unique populations served.
